Motherhood is an incredibly transformative experience, but it can also be a time of great mental upheaval. Many new mothers encounter a range of states that can range from intense happiness to feelings of sadness. These fluctuations are completely understandable, but if they begin to overwhelm your daily life, seeking therapy can be an incredibly positive step.
Therapists focused in postpartum mentorship can provide a safe space for you to process your emotions. They can also offer strategies to help you manage these challenges and develop your capacity as a new mother.
Therapy can be particularly useful for tackling issues such as postpartum depression, marital stress, and sleep deprivation. It can also support you in finding balance and nurturing a healthy relationship with both yourself and your infant.
Remember, seeking help is not a sign of failure; it's a brave step towards healing.
Embracing Through Grief Counseling: Finding Peace and Resilience
Grief can be a profoundly painful experience, leaving us lost. Often, the weight of our sorrow can feel insurmountable. It's during these challenging times that grief counseling emerges as a valuable tool for healing and growth. A qualified grief counselor provides a safe and supportive space to process our emotions, navigate the complexities of loss, and ultimately find peace and resilience. Through guided sessions, individuals can acquire coping mechanisms, remember their loved ones in meaningful ways, and begin to rebuild a new path forward.
Grief counseling is not about ignoring the pain; rather, it's about acknowledging our grief, working through it into our lives, and finding purpose in our experiences. It's a journey that takes time and dedication, but the rewards are immeasurable. By engaging in grief counseling, we can tap into our own inner healing and emerge from loss with a renewed sense of strength.

Empowering Yourself: Adult ADHD Treatment & Support
Living with adult ADHD can feel like navigating a constant uphill battle. Symptoms like inattention and distractibility can make it challenging to keep up in work, relationships, and everyday life. However, there's encouragement – effective treatments and support systems can help you manage ADHD and live a more fulfilling life.
- Coaching can provide valuable tools to strengthen coping mechanisms, improve time management, and strengthen self-esteem.
- Medication can be a helpful complement to therapy, managing some of the core ADHD symptoms.
- Communities offer a safe and understanding space to connect with others who experience similar challenges.
Remember, you're not alone in this journey. By pursuing treatment and support, you can transform yourself and unlock your full potential.
